Are you Just Making Small Talk?
Or is it Building a Relationship to Help Your Buyers
 
Sometimes making small talk is a good thing, and not a waste of time. At least depending on what you are chatting about, and with whom.
 
In our competitive market many properties are getting multiple offers, and to compete effectively you must put your best offer forward.
 
Obviously terms and conditions, price, financial qualifications, a complete and well-constructed offer, and other matters are important in order to have a good shot at being the winning offer.
 
But developing a positive relationship with the listing agent early on is essential, too, in my book. Why not get to know the other person a bit while you are finding out what the seller is looking for (e.g., closing time, need for a potential rent back, what appliances are conveying and what’s not) and anything else that might be important for crafting a strong offer for your buyer.
 
A good relationship can work wonders when your offer is being presented and the listing agent has good things to say about you, knowing you, or having met you over the phone or in person.
